This time, he shaved first. Joaquin Phoenix appeared on the Late Show with David Letterman for the first time since the infamous 2009 show, which has since been revealed to have been ‘acting’ for his mockumentary film, I’m Still Here.

Beard gone and flab flayed, Phoenix, 35, looked like a totally different man. Unlike the last time, Phoenix was articulate, present and charming. "People don’t let guys like you out if you’re really like that," Letterman, 63, told him of his put-on slide into hirsute debauchery. The actor cleared up some misconceptions about the film, emphasizing that Letterman had not been in on the hoax from the beginning.

He went on to apologize to the host. "You’ve interviewed many, many people and I assumed that you would know the difference between a character and a real person, so — but I apologize. I hope I didn’t offend you in any way." Letterman was unfazed. "It was like batting practice," he said. –AMY LEE
